NEW DELHI: A 43-year-old man was stabbed to death and another was injured after a late-night altercation with two youngsters in outer Delhi’s Mangolpuri, police said on Friday. The incident occurred around 1 am, and police were alerted after Sanjay Gandhi Memorial Hospital reported that one person had been brought dead and another injured.The deceased, identified as Sanjay Singh, lived in Mangolpuri and had a single stab wound to the chest. Police said he was unmarried, unemployed, and lived with his siblings after the death of his parents. The injured man, Anil, 45, who is also from the same locality, sustained a stab injury on the right side of his abdomen. He was operated on and is now stable, according to a senior police officer.According to the initial investigation, both men were in an inebriated state and sitting by the roadside when a van stopped nearby. Two young men stepped out of the vehicle, and a brief argument followed. Police said the assailants allegedly stabbed both victims during the quarrel.“All accused have been identified and apprehended. They have confessed to the crime, and the weapon of offence has been recovered,” the officer said.Police added that both sides had consumed alcohol before the altercation.
